Transaction 33ea7278bbc15b0739688bf996310129f0987504ebc8899c2b2e8848dbb7783a
1 Input
1 Output
-
33ea7278bbc15b0739688bf996310129f0987504ebc8899c2b2e8848dbb7783a:0
- value
- 88876892
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ae56499fa277dd4cc2835e809dd9d285b7fe2a4b
- address
- bc1q4etyn8azwlw5es5rt6qfmkwjskmlu2jt0d7hz6